The aircraft has to be on DGCA approved list AT THE TIME OF APPLICATION of your endorsement/IR renewal at DGCA office.

If you have obtained NOC from DGCA, you can leave for training on that aircraft overseas, but you will have to wait till it is approved here before you can put in your papers at DGCA to have it endorsed on your Indian licence.
